FAQS about Tuoketo power plant energy storage project

Where is Tuoketuo Power Plant located?

Tuoketuo Power Plant is a 6,720MW coal fired power project. It is located in Inner Mongolia, China. According to GlobalData, who tracks and profiles over 170,000 power plants worldwide, the project is currently active. It has been developed in multiple phases. Post completion of construction, the project got commissioned in June 2003.

Who owns Tuoketuo Power Station?

The plant was commissioned in November 1995 by the Tuoketuo Power Company, which currently owns and operates the power station. The units of the facility were commissioned in six separate phases, each phase consisting of two units, rated at 600 MW each, all of which run on coal.

What is Tuoketuo Power Plant XI?

Tuoketuo Power Plant (Tuoketuo Power Plant Unit XI) consists of 1 steam turbine with 660MW nameplate capacity. Tuoketuo Power Plant (Tuoketuo Power Plant Unit XII) consists of 1 steam turbine with 660MW nameplate capacity. The project got commissioned in June 2003.

What is Datang Tuoketuo Power Plant?

Datang Tuoketuo Power Plant, with an installed capacity of 6720MW, is the world’s largest thermal power plant. It is in transition into a 10-million-kW "wind-solar-thermal-storage" multi-energy complementary comprehensive energy base, providing green energy to the capital city Beijing.

Which steam turbine is used in Tuoketuo Power Plant?

Tuoketuo Power Plant (Tuoketuo Power Plant Unit II) is equipped with Mitsubishi Power TC4F-40 steam turbine. The phase consists of 1 steam turbine with 600MW nameplate capacity. Tuoketuo Power Plant (Tuoketuo Power Plant Unit III) is equipped with Dongfang Turbine N600-16.7/538/538-1 steam turbine.
